Transaction 70bb70cdfc8d9ba405f299c97c284fc47d77e4e999171e32b8b7ac8ebefdfeb6

2 Input
1 Outputs
  • 70bb70cdfc8d9ba405f299c97c284fc47d77e4e999171e32b8b7ac8ebefdfeb6:0
  • value  599439
    address  3FBqUD3DLxW78jXRDLz9nX4RdW6LSvNS2K